No song titles on radio

Featured Replies

Hi everyone I hope you can help. I have a Ford Kuga ST 2017 model. I recently took it to the garage for its annual service and since bringing it home have noticed the song names / DJs on my radio stations (Heart/ Capital etc) no longer show. Does anyone know how I can fix this. I’m guessing it is where they disconnected the battery?

Hope you can help

Thank you

Jenna



Are you sure it is on DAB and the garage haven't changed it over to FM ?

  • Author

No it is definitely on DAB.

Then it is just going to be that the option to display song titles etc. is switched off in the settings.
